A chiasm is a literary structure where vocabulary of the first section of a passage is repeated in reverse order in the second. The center of the chiasm is typically the climax of the passage. In Mark 11:11-27 the center and climax is Jesus in the temple saying, “Is it not written, ‘My house shall be called a house of prayer for all nations’? But you have made it robbers’ den.” But when the chief priests and scribes heard this they began seeking how to destroy him (Mark 11:17-18).
